WebSep 8, 2024 · Yes, the thing that cricketers famously use to oil their bats! Flaxseed oil is rich in a particular type of Omega 3 fatty acid called alpha-linolenic acid, shortened to ALA. ALA is mostly found in plants, and is considered to be an essential fatty acid as it is not created in the body. Outside of flaxseeds, common sources of ALA include chia ... Flaxseed (Linum usitatissimum) and flaxseed oil, which comes from flaxseed, are rich sources of the essential fatty acid alpha-linolenic acid — a heart … WebSep 17, 2024 · The problem with Flaxseed oil. Yes, there is Omega-3 in Flaxseed oil. But the human body cannot efficiently use the kind of Omega-3 found in Flax (ALA). EPA and DHA are the Omega-3 found in fish and fish oil supplements. This is what your body really needs. Your body easily uses the Omega-3 from fish oil. With Flax, your body has to … easter bunny ceramics

WebThe short answer, without question, is fish oil is not only better bio-available omega 3 fatty acid but it is also a much more cost-effective source. We have found better results treating dry eye syndrome by eliminating the flaxseed oil and greatly increasing the EPA and DHA (we like 2000 mg to 3000 mg of EPA and DHA combined). The fatty acids in flaxseed and fish oil may help dry eye conditions by reducing inflammation, improving eye gland tear production, and regulating hormones that may cause dry eye symptoms. Some studies and medical organizations support the theory that omega-3 fatty acids are beneficial in treating dry eye problems.

Fish oil has EPA and DHA directly to the blood and body. Flaxseed oil has ALA, which is then changed into EPA and DHA within the body [62, 63]. However, for vegetarian or vegan people, flaxseed oil could be a way to meet omega-3 daily needs and receive the …
